Listing in New South Wales
How many businesses are listed in New South Wales?
2,062 across 36 towns and 192 categories. Coverage starts on the border corridor and expands region by region, so a town with no listings does not yet have a page.
Do you list Victoria businesses that work in New South Wales?
Yes, and that is the point of the site. Where a business is registered and where it works are stored as separate things, so a Victoria operator that services a New South Wales town appears on that town’s pages without claiming an address it does not have.
How do I get my New South Wales business listed?
Add it or claim an existing entry. It is free, there is no trial, and no part of the free tier expires. Verification is a separate step: we check a trade licence against the state register and show the date we checked.
